Suggest a better descriptionMix dry ingredients well. Dissolve yeast in warm water and add oil and mix into dry ingredients. Add more warm water to make a soft mixture. Place in greased muffin tins or bread pans. Let stand 45 minutes and bake in a preheated 375 oven until bread is browned on top with cracks, about 30 minutes Note 1: brown rice flour is available at health food stores Note 2: gluten free baked goods dont tend to rise as high or be a light textured as gluten flours and they tend to stale quicker.
